Understanding Dental Crowns: The Foundation of Tooth Restoration
Dental crowns are custom-designed, tooth-shaped caps that completely cover a damaged or compromised natural tooth. Made from various high-quality materials, these crowns serve to strengthen, restore function, and improve the appearance of your teeth. Whether you’re dealing with a fractured tooth, severe decay, or aesthetic concerns, crowns offer a durable and reliable solution.
Types of Dental Crowns and Their Unique Benefits
- Ceramic or Porcelain Crowns: These are the most popular choice for front teeth due to their natural appearance, mimicking the translucency and color of real teeth.
- Zirconia Crowns: Known for exceptional strength and durability, zirconia crowns are suitable for both front and back teeth, providing excellent aesthetics and longevity.
- Porcelain-Fused-to-Metal (PFM) Crowns: Combining the aesthetics of porcelain with the strength of metal, these crowns are versatile and durable.
- Metal Crowns: Usually made from gold or another metal alloy, these crowns are highly durable and ideal for molars that endure significant biting forces.
The Process of Getting a Dental Crown at Kensington Dental Studio
Obtaining a dental crown typically involves multiple steps, carefully managed by our experienced dental team and hygienists to ensure optimal results. Here is a detailed overview of the process:
Step 1: Initial Examination and Consultation
The journey begins with a thorough dental examination. Our dental hygienists assess the health of your teeth and gums, taking X-rays if necessary. During this consultation, we discuss your aesthetic goals, functional needs, and any concerns you may have.
Step 2: Tooth Preparation and Impression Taking
To prepare the tooth for the crown, the damaged or decayed portion is carefully removed. The tooth is then shaped to accommodate the crown, ensuring a snug and natural fit. An impression of the prepared tooth is taken using digital or traditional methods, which is critical for crafting a precise, custom crown.
Step 3: Fabrication of the Crown
The impression is sent to a dental laboratory where skilled technicians craft your dental crown. Depending on the material selected, the process may take a few days. Meanwhile, our team may fit you with a temporary crown to protect the prepared tooth.
Step 4: Fitting and Cementation
Once your custom crown is ready, you return to our clinic for the fitting. Our dental hygienists ensure the crown fits perfectly, matches your surrounding teeth, and functions seamlessly. After confirming the fit, the crown is permanently cemented in place, restoring your tooth's strength and appearance.
The Benefits of Dental Crowns: Why They Are a Vital Part of Modern Dentistry
Dental crowns offer numerous advantages that make them an invaluable solution for various dental issues. Here are some key benefits:
Restoration of Functionality
Dental crowns restore the full functionality of teeth, allowing you to chew, bite, and speak confidently without discomfort or fear of further damage.
Protection of Weak or Damaged Teeth
If a tooth has been weakened by decay or trauma, a crown acts as a protective shield, preventing further deterioration or fracture.
Enhancement of Aesthetic Appeal
Porcelain and ceramic crowns provide a natural look, seamlessly blending with your existing teeth to improve your smile’s appearance.
Durability and Longevity
When cared for properly, dental crowns can last 10 to 15 years or longer, providing long-lasting results and excellent ROI for your dental investment.
Encouragement of Oral Health
Crowns help preserve the underlying tooth structure, maintain proper alignment, and facilitate better overall oral hygiene by covering and protecting compromised teeth.

Hygienic Practices for Crown Maintenance
- Consistent brushing at least twice daily using fluoride toothpaste to remove plaque and food debris.
- Flossing daily around the crowns and between teeth to prevent plaque buildup.
- Routine dental check-ups and professional cleanings every 6 months to monitor crown integrity and overall oral health.
- Avoiding hard or sticky foods that could damage the crown or weaken its bond.
- Using gentle tools and techniques recommended by our hygienists to prevent accidental damage.
